Full Mean.

My new short short story collection came out today on Amazon. It's called The Reek of Blood and, I've got to say, it's a nasty piece of work.

That's not to say the last few ebooks I've released haven't had their horrific elements, they do, but this new book goes into even darker, nastier territory.

The middle story in particular strays into some unpleasant and unsettling territory. It's probably the most Shaun Hutson-esque story I've ever written. If you're familiar with his work that's going to give you a big clue about The Bitter Salve.

It was written a few years ago and I'm not sure where it came from. I wasn't in a particularly bad mood, I didn't feel the need for some cathartic release and nothing unusual had happened in my life. I just had the need to dredge up something that would bother a reader's stomach as much as it would unsettle their mind.

Sometimes you just have to go Full Mean and see where it goes.
